§ 6.06.03 Auditor: powers and duties.
   The Auditor shall attend all regular meetings of Council, and may be requested to attend any special or committee meetings. The Auditor (and the Manager) shall execute on behalf of the City all contracts, conveyances, evidences of indebtedness and all other instruments to which the City is a party.
   The Auditor shall be the fiscal officer of the City. He shall serve the Manager and the Council as financial adviser in connection with City affairs, shall be responsible for the preparation and submission of the annual estimate of receipts and expenditures and appropriation measures and shall at all times keep the Manager and Council informed of the financial condition and needs of the City. He shall authenticate all records, documents and instruments of the City on which authentication are proper. The Auditor shall examine all payrolls, bills and other claims against the City and shall issue no warrant unless he shall find that the claim is in proper form, correctly computed and duly approved, that it is due and payable, that a lawful appropriation has been made therefore, and that the amount required to pay said claim is in the treasury or in process of collection to the credit of an appropriate fund free from any previous encumbrances. He shall perform such other duties consistent with their office as the Manager or the Council may request and shall comply with the laws of Ohio relating to certifications for expenditures of public moneys.
